Identifying Common Wildlife Intruders



Recognizing common wild animals intruders is a crucial very first step in effective wild animals administration. Comprehending the specific varieties that often penetrate commercial and property rooms allows residential or commercial property owners and wild animals experts to implement targeted approaches for mitigating prospective damages and health dangers. Usual intruders commonly consist of raccoons, squirrels, bats, and various types of birds and rats, each bringing special obstacles.


Raccoons, for instance, are understood for their mastery and can cause considerable architectural damages while seeking food or shelter. Squirrels, with their propensity for gnawing, can harm electric circuitry, positioning fire dangers. Bats, while beneficial for managing insect populaces, can end up being a hassle when they roost in attics, potentially spreading illness such as histoplasmosis. Birds, including sparrows and pigeons, commonly develop unhygienic conditions with their droppings, leading to structural deterioration and health and wellness problems. Rodents, such as computer mice and rats, are infamous for their quick reproduction and capability to penetrate tiny openings, positioning severe health threats because of their capacity to spread out diseases.


Humane Exemption Strategies



Recognizing the usual wildlife trespassers is the foundation upon which reliable exemption methods are developed. Determining types such as squirrels, raccoons, and birds assists in designing gentle exclusion techniques tailored to certain behaviors and access methods. Exemption is a preventative approach focused on refuting wildlife accessibility to homes and residential or commercial properties, therefore decreasing the demand for more invasive steps.


The keystone of humane exemption involves securing potential entrance points. This includes fixing holes in walls, structures, and roofs, as well as setting up smokeshaft caps and vent covers. For smaller intruders like bats and computer mice, using products such as steel woollen and caulk to seal spaces is important. Furthermore, guaranteeing that home windows and doors are safe, which screens are undamaged, can even more hinder entry.


Another key method is making use of acoustic and aesthetic deterrents. Mounting ultrasonic devices or motion-activated lights can prevent nocturnal wildlife. Customizing the habitat by handling food resources, such as safeguarding garbage can and removing bird feeders, additionally plays a vital duty. These exemption approaches not only protect the home environment but also value the wildlife, permitting them to flourish in their natural habitats without injury.


Safe Capturing Techniques



When exclusion techniques are insufficient, secure capturing methods come to be an essential option in wildlife monitoring. Capturing, when performed correctly, supplies a humane and reliable means of addressing an immediate wild animals problem while making certain very little tension and injury to the animal. This approach needs an understanding of both the behavior of the target varieties and the honest factors to consider associated with wildlife handling.


The very first step in safe capturing involves selecting the proper trap kind. Live traps, such as cage catches, are normally recommended as they enable the capture and release of the animal somewhere else. These traps have to be inspected frequently to stop unnecessary tension or injury to the captured wildlife. It is crucial to comply with neighborhood regulations relating to capturing and relocation to make sure compliance with legal criteria and wildlife conservation concepts. wildlife removal Burlington.


In addition, lure choice and positioning are crucial parts in ensuring effective trapping. Lure ought to be selected based on the nutritional preferences of the target types and tactically put to lure the animal into the trap. Once trapped, the pet should be handled with treatment, making use of safety equipment if essential, to promote secure transportation and launch, therefore keeping a serene home and a balanced community environment.


Preventative Home Modifications



While secure capturing techniques attend to instant wildlife concerns, lasting options commonly require preventative home alterations to prevent animals from entering human rooms. Carrying out these modifications not only boosts the safety and security and comfort of your living environment yet likewise decreases the likelihood of future wild animals invasions.




A critical element of preventative approaches is sealing possible entrance factors. This involves evaluating and repairing any kind of spaces or cracks in the structure, wall surfaces, and roofing system, as these can come to be access courses for wildlife. Setting up smokeshaft caps and repairing damaged vents can prevent birds, bats, and rodents from obtaining entry. Safeguarding doors and windows with weather removing and harmonize screens includes an extra layer of security.


Landscaping adjustments can likewise function as reliable deterrents. Cutting tree branches that overhang the roof covering and getting rid of particles heaps can remove courses and environments that bring in wild animals. Preserving a clean lawn by protecting trash bins and compost heap discourages scavengers such as webpage marsupials and raccoons.
